Heumann Lagona is a full bodied red wine from Villany, Hungary. It's a blend of Merlot, Cabernet Franc, Cabernet Sauvignon and Kekfrankos with 14.0% abv. Suitable for Vegetarians.
Here's a great value, quality red from German-Swiss winemakers Evelyne and Erhard Heumann, made in the warmth of the Villany region in Hungary. Lagona is a soft red wine leads with aromas of red berries and vanilla. On the palate are red plums, meaty leather, raspberries and cocoa along a velvet-smooth tannin. The 15 year old vines lend concentration to the fruit, while 22 months' maturation in Hungarian barriques gives the wine an elegant structure and a long finish. Drink now or mature for up to another six years.
Pairs beautifully with: Sirloin steak, beef stroganoff, a posh cheeseburger with blue cheese and steak chunk, roast duck or grilled mushrooms and garlic.
Cheese pairing: Cheshire, Red Leicester (especially Red Storm wax hard cheese), mature Cheddar or Parmesan.
